General Admissibility of Relevant Evidence

Indiana Rules of Evidence

Rule: 402

Jurisdiction: IN

Bluebook Citation: Ind. R. Evid. 402

Effective January 1, 2014 Relevant evidence is admissible unless any of the following provides otherwise: (a) the United States Constitution; (b) the Indiana constitution; (c) a statute not in conflict with these rules; (d) these rules; or (e) other rules applicable in the courts of this state. Irrelevant evidence is not admissible.
